Reads one DICOM series, sorts slices by ImagePositionPatient, applies
RescaleSlope and RescaleIntercept, builds an affine from orientation and
spacing tags, and writes a .nii.gz plus JSON summary.
python scripts/series_to_volume.py PATH_TO_DICOM_DIR --output PATH_TO_OUT.nii.gz

Key output fields: n_slices, series_instance_uid, output.path,
output.shape, output.spacing, output.axcodes, output.affine,
hu_range, and runtime.conversion_seconds.
Scope limits: single-series CT only; no multi-frame DICOM, compressed transfer
syntax handling, RT structure sets, auto-reorientation, or clinical use.
